'Ode to Trevor Marshall'


Monte Carlo

"Thought I'd put togther a little tune to show off the sounds of this mega synth.
This is the second 5600 I've owned, the first I sold after reparing it some years ago and quickly regretted selling it. When another one came up for sale I bought it and then spent ages fixing lots of little faults, including an original design error on the LFO. Now it's working perfectly.
The synth is controlled by midi from a midi to CV converter. The CV has to be exponential but the on-board exponential converter does not produce totally clean output, so I made my own converter which runs off batteries.
All the sounds are from the synth, except the drums. I added basic FX: chorus, phaser, reverb and echo to the parts.

BTW, Trevor Marshall is the genius who created this classic synth."

u-he CVilization Mode III: Quad Mucorder


u-he

"Mode III turns CVilization into a 'Quad Mucorder': A 4-Channel CV step recorder that can mutate your sequences. Record, play back and overdub on all 4 tracks simultaneously! Quantization with 9 scales, advanced clocking options including Bus Gate, clock division, glide and sequencer reset can also be added and adjusted individually for all 4 tracks. If you like your mutated sequence, you can save it, replacing the original sequence."

How to play the "Soldering Synthesizer" by Neya-Gakki

How to play the "Soldering Synthesizer" by Neya-Gakki ねや楽器さんの「ソルダリングシンセサイザー」の演奏方法
PikoPiko Factory ピコピコファクトリー

Somewhere between reverse DIY and live circuit bending...



via R-MONO Lab

"ソルダリング・シンセサイザーは半田ゴテを使って演奏する新感覚のシンセサイザーです。ツマミも鍵盤も一切使わない革新的な演奏方法を確立しました。半田ショートでリズム・パターンを変えるだけでなく、抵抗やコンデンサを直接取り替えることでドラスティックな変化を楽しむことができます。"

Googlish:

"The Soldering Synthesizer is a new type of synthesizer that uses a soldering iron to play. We have established an innovative playing method that does not use any knobs or keyboards. Not only can you change the rhythm pattern with a solder short, but you can also enjoy drastic changes by directly replacing resistors and capacitors."

Low Frequency Expander 2.0 by Yorick Tech



"Announcing the Low Frequency Expander 2.0, a major firmware upgrade, free to all users, available from December 2020.

The LFE is a standalone, hardware modulation expander that supports the OB-6 and Prophet 6, Korg Prologue, Nord Wave 2 and a generic ‘CC-Synth’: any midi device that can be controlled by midi CC messages. It uses midi to provide 3 complex global LFOs and a 6-stage envelope – which can also be configured as an 2 to 16-step modulation sequencer – to add considerably more complexity, movement and playability to these amazing synthesizers. It also acts as a 4-slot modulation matrix, allowing you to route velocity, key, aftertouch, mod wheel or CV in (optional) to about 50 destinations in the synth (80 with the Nord!)

Simply selecting a new patch on the synth makes the LFE automatically recall the same- numbered LFE patch from its memory, so the two have their patches locked together. You can select the next (or previous) patch in the same category, stepping through all of the Bass patches for example.

New in 2.0
Support for the Rev 4 Prophets 5 and 10, and Moog Voyager. CC-Synth and any two synths are included free; others are extra cost.

Internal midi clock for controlling the LFE and external devices.

The synth’s patch names can now be read and displayed by the LFE, so if you edit patches using for example Sound Tower, the LFE can get these directly form the synth even though the synth itself can’t display them.

Release Aftertouch (RAT) allows you to fix an aftertouch value just before releasing the last note and hold that value until the next note is played. This can be used in a similar way to release velocity, which is sadly only generated by a few keyboards. RAT lets you, for example, increase Release times or increase FX depth just by giving the keys a quick press before releasing them.
The LFE now supports Poly Chaining using any keyboard as master and any synth as slave. The LFE handles all of the note sharing so the attached keyboards simply remain in their normal mode.

You can limit the number of voices played, add a second Sub Voice like a sub oscillator but at any pitch, and can add a velocity offset to the sub voice, so that for example, a second voice a 5th higher comes in only when played with more velocity."
